Comprehensive Guide to Window Installation and Repair
Windows are important features of any structure, supplying natural light, ventilation, and looks. Appropriate installation and timely repairs are important for optimizing their performance and efficiency. This short article checks out the complexities of window installation and repair, highlighting different kinds of windows, common problems, and the steps associated with preserving them.

Understanding the numerous kinds of windows readily available can help property owners make notified choices regarding installation and repair.
Single-Hung Windows
Single-hung windows include two sashes, where just the lower sash opens. They are a popular option for conventional homes due to their classic design and price.
Double-Hung Windows
Comparable to single-hung windows, double-hung windows have two operable sashes that enable increased ventilation. They are easy to clean and are frequently discovered in modern homes.
Casement Windows
Casement windows are hinged on one side and open external, supplying exceptional airflow. They are energy-efficient and ideal for hard-to-reach areas.
Sliding Windows
Sliding windows consist of 2 or more sashes that move horizontally. They provide a modern-day look and facilitate outdoor watching while allowing natural light to flood the space.
Bay/Bow Windows
Bay and bow windows project outside from the structure, producing a nook within the space. Their special design boosts the aesthetic appeal and offers breathtaking views.
Typical Window Problems
Even the most well-installed windows can establish concerns with time. Understanding these problems is essential for timely repairs.
Drafts
Drafty windows can result in energy loss and pain. Typical causes include used weatherstripping and gaps in the installation.
Wetness Accumulation
Moisture in windows can lead to mold growth and damage to the frame, generally caused by seal failure or poor installation.
Broken or Cracked Glass
Unintentional impacts or extreme weather condition can result in broken or broken glass. This not only impacts looks however also compromises energy effectiveness and safety.
Hard Operation
Windows that are difficult to open or close might indicate issues with the frame, hardware breakdown, or buildup of dirt and particles.
Window Installation Process
Setting up new windows requires mindful planning and execution to ensure optimal efficiency.
PreparationMeasurement: Measure the window frame properly to make sure a correct fit.Choice: Choose windows that match your home's style and meet energy effectiveness requirements.Gathering Tools: Ensure you have all necessary tools at hand, consisting of a level, screwdriver, and measuring tape.Removal of Old WindowsEliminate Trim: Carefully take off the interior and outside trim.Take Out the Sashes: Remove the old sashes and examine for any damage to the frame.Tidy the Opening: Clear the area of particles and prepare the frame for the brand-new windows.Installation of New WindowsPosition the Window: Insert the new window into the frame and ensure it is level.Secure the Window: Use shims to support the window and attach it to the frame.Inspect Operation: Open and close the window to validate functionality.Sealing and InsulationSeal the Edges: Apply caulk around the edges to lower air leaks.Install Insulation: Use insulation product to fill any spaces.Last Inspection and CleanupInspect Operation: Ensure the window opens, closes, and locks efficiently.Reattach Trim: Reinstall the window trim and clean up any particles left from installation.Window Repair Techniques
Keeping windows is necessary for optimizing their life-span.
Minor RepairsRepairing Drafts: Replace worn weatherstripping or caulk to seal gaps.Cleansing: Regularly tidy the window tracks and hinges to improve functionality.Glass ReplacementRemove the Damaged Glass: Carefully take out shattered glass and clean the frame.Set Up New Glass: Using a glazing compound, secure the new glass in place and seal it properly.Weatherstripping
Including or replacing weatherstripping around the window can significantly improve energy efficiency by preventing air from getting in or getting away.
Frequently asked questionsWhat is the typical expense of window installation?
The average cost of window installation can vary significantly, generally varying from ₤ 300 to ₤ 1,000 per window, depending upon the type and materials picked.
How often should windows be replaced?
Windows must usually be changed every 15 to 20 years, however this can vary based on the quality of the products and local climate condition.
Can I set up or repair windows myself?
While DIY window installation and repair are possible, it can be difficult. It is typically suggested to employ specialists to guarantee appropriate installation and prevent prospective issues.
How can I enhance the energy effectiveness of my windows?
To improve energy efficiency, consider alternatives such as Double glazing Windows Repair or triple-pane glass, low-emissivity (Low-E) coatings, and appropriate weather stripping.
